Bell Gardens was the 8-2 winner over King/Drew when they last played one another back in March of 2024, but their luck changed this time around. Bell Gardens fell just short of King/Drew by a score of 4-3 on Monday. The Lancers have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Nayeli Gomez made the most of her time at bat despite the final result and went 1-for-2 with one home run and two RBI. The team also got some help courtesy of Sophia Meza, who scored a run while going 2-for-3.
Bell Gardens' defeat dropped their record down to 8-6. As for King/Drew, the victory snapped their losing streak at four games and leaves them with a 3-6 record.
Bell Gardens didn't take long to hit the field again: they've already played their next matchup, a 21-0 win against San Gabriel on the 20th. As for King/Drew, they also wasted no time getting back out on the field and have already played their next game, a 5-4 loss against Wiseburn- Da Vinci on the 20th.
